Technical Details
Repair Capabilities
- Remove markdown code fences (
```json...```) - Balance brackets/braces (close unclosed arrays/objects)
- Fix trailing commas (
[1, 2,]→[1, 2]) - Quote unquoted keys (
{name: "x"}→{"name": "x"}) - Convert single quotes to double quotes
- Replace NaN/Infinity with null
- Repair truncated numbers (
12.3from streaming) - Type coercion for schema validation
- Required field injection (when safe)
Confidence Scoring
- High: Only syntax repairs (guaranteed safe)
- Medium: Schema repairs or minor warnings
- Low: Complex repairs or critical warnings
